diff --git a/.github/workflows/update-deps.yml b/.github/workflows/update-deps.yml index 32e09730..2f8de2c0 100644 --- a/.github/workflows/update-deps.yml +++ b/.github/workflows/update-deps.yml @@ -58,8 +58,18 @@ jobs: token: ${{ steps.app_token.outputs.token }} - name: Download latest binaries. run: script/sentry-cli-download.sh + - name: Resolve bot user ID for noreply email + id: bot_user + env: + GH_TOKEN: ${{ steps.app_token.outputs.token }} + run: | + BOT_ID=$(gh api "users/${{ steps.app_token.outputs.app-slug }}%5Bbot%5D" --jq .id) + echo "id=${BOT_ID}" >> "${GITHUB_OUTPUT}" - name: Commit latest binaries. uses: stefanzweifel/git-auto-commit-action@04702edda442b2e678b25b537cec683a1493fcb9 # v7.1.0 with: branch: ${{ needs.update-cli.outputs.prBranch }} commit_message: bump bundled binaries + commit_author: "${{ steps.app_token.outputs.app-slug }}[bot] <${{ steps.bot_user.outputs.id }}+${{ steps.app_token.outputs.app-slug }}[bot]@users.noreply.github.com>" + commit_user_name: "${{ steps.app_token.outputs.app-slug }}[bot]" + commit_user_email: "${{ steps.bot_user.outputs.id }}+${{ steps.app_token.outputs.app-slug }}[bot]@users.noreply.github.com"